Comprehending Ocellated Turkey Diets

Ocellated turkeys are fascinating creatures with a extensive diet that reflects their versatile nature. These colorful birds mostly forage for food on the ground, scrounging through leaves, undergrowth for a selection of wholesome items. A key component of their consumption is foliage, which includes berries, seeds, nuts, and sometimes fruits.

  • Additionally, they are known to consume small insects such as grubs, helping them maintain a balanced diet.

Nurturing Ocellated Turkeys: A Guide for Beginners

Ocellated turkeys are stunning birds known for their bold plumage and feisty personalities. While they can be a bit intensive to care for than some other poultry breeds, with the right strategies, raising ocellated turkeys can be a rewarding experience.

To get started, explore providing your turkeys with a protected and comfortable coop. They need a mix of scratching opportunities in their enclosure to keep them stimulated.

Be sure to provide fresh water and a wholesome diet that includes both grains and insect-based options. Remember that ocellated turkeys are flock animals and thrive when kept in pairs.
